Kyewords Importance and Uses

The first step in the area of search engine marketing (SEM) is to understand the relevance & importance of keywords. Keywords are the starting blocks of a successful SEM campaign.

So lets dig into this section of SEM (or specifically SEO, search engine optimization) by defining keywords & keyphrases.

KEYWORDS and KEYPHARASES Definition : site words or phrases which/that are matched with the search words or phrases of target audience using search engines are known as keywords and key phrases.

Importance of KEYWORDS and KEYPHARASES : Keywords and Keypharases are used to promote and market a website by improving search engine rankings.

Where to use KEYWORDS and KEYPHARASES for Offpage Optimization : The Keywords and keypharases are used as the anchor text to link to the site. Search engines specially google attach lot of importance to the anchor text hence if there is a keyword in it, the site gets promoted for that keyword.

The Keywords and keypharases are also used to advertise, promote and market site with PPC (pay per click) and PPI(pay per impression)

Where to use KEYWORDS and KEYPHARASES for Onpage Optimization : KEYWORDS and KEYPHARASES are generally used with HTML tags ( title tag, meta description tag, meta keywords tags, body tag , anchor tags, comment tags, heading tags, alt tags, table tags, form tags, list tags, formatting tags, frame tags, map tags, applet tags, etc.) and in url itself. Apart from this the keywords & key phrases are used in the text matter of the page.

These are also used to create KRPs (Keyword Rich Pages – where a specific KEYWORD and KEYPHARASE is repeated to get top ranking for that particular web page for a particular KEYWORD).

The strategy is to target one keyword or at maximum two, per page. Once these KRPs are produced it is easier to get these pages ranked with search engines. These pages then have links to other pages in the site & hence serve as the passage way for inviting in the surfer to investigate the site deeply. These Keyword rich optimized pages are also called ‘Doorway Pages.’

KEYWORDS and KEYPHARASES uses in THE PAGE TITLE :
--------------------------------------------------

Page title is the first element that search spiders’ find on a web page and hence it stands to reason that the title of each page should be carefully crafted.

THE PAGE TITLE text is displayed by using ….. tags in the title bar of the web browser. As it is one of the most important element of the webpage therefore most important and essential KEYWORD AND KEYPHARASE (S) must be included in it. KEYWORDS and KEYPHARASES which are used in page title are used by search engines in their result listing and they are then used by the target audience as the hyperlink to


access the website from the search engine results page(SERP).

Keywords in a title is generally upto 60 characters or less including spaces. Google cutsoff title text after 60 characters when it is displayed in the SERPs. To achieve high ranking on the search engines the main keyword or phrase for the web page should appear should appear in the beginning of the title on the page. The page title tag carries significant weight in most search engine algorithms.

Example:

The page title “ keyword & kyphrases tutorial for search engine marketing “ uses keywords ( keyword , keyphrases, tutorial, search engine marketing)

These keywords and keypharases are dependent upon the domain, nature and objective of the web site.

KEYWORDS and KEYPHARASES uses in THE META TAGS :
-------------------------------------------------

Meta Tags : Meta Tags are html text which describe information about the web page. In other words they provide data about data(web page content). Meta tags are invisible on the web page. They do not appear in browser window. To access them one has to select View menu and then select sourcece option from menu bar of browser Each meta tag has both a 'name' and a 'content' attribute.

In fact Meta tags are one of the first elements I look at, while assessing a competitor web site.

Meta tags are placed after the tag (position of Meta Tags is not fixed. If you put Meta tags elsewhere the page will not suffer).

The purpose of using the meta tag is to add relevant keywords that could be used by search engines while indexing a page.

example





Keyword and description meta tags can hold up to 1000 characters . Keyword and description meta tags should not repeat same keyword more than seven times otherwise some search engines will regard this as spam. It is better to avoid those keywords and phrases that have nothing to do with the page although search engines do not punish pages that include keywords that cannot be found elsewhere on the page.

As you can see we have chosen not to include commas. The search engines don't mind and it opens up for new keyword combinations. "search engine optimization techniques" includes no less than eight keyword or keyword phrases, including "search engine" and "optimization techniques".
